NEET PG 2025: Exam Date (June 15), Eligibility, Registration, Syllabus, Pattern

According to the NMC's most recent notification, the tentative date of the NEET PG 2025 exam is June 15, 2025. To take the NEET PG 2025 exam, candidates must register online and fill out the application form. The NBE will publish the NEET PG 2025 essential date and full timetable in its official information bulletin.

The official website, "natboard.edu.in", will be where you begin the online NEET PG 2025 registration. The schedule and NEET PG 2025 eligibility criteria will be mentioned in the information brochure that the NBE releases. The application form errors will be fixed during the NEET PG correction window in 2025. Both the exam and the NEET PG admit card 2025 will be available online. A merit list will be created and the authorities will announce the NEET PG 2025 result as a scorecard. MCC will conduct NEET PG counseling in 2025 based on the generated merit list.

NEET PG 2025: Highlights

An outline of the NEET PG 2025 exam is provided below to provide students with an idea of what to expect:

Particulars Details
Exam name National Eligibility cum Entrance Test for Post-Graduate courses (NEET PG)
Frequency of exam Once a year
Conducting Body National Board of Examinations in Medical Sciences, New Delhi (NBEMS)
Official website
  • nbe.edu.in
  • natboard.edu.in
Courses offered MD/MS/PG Diploma/DNB post-MBBS
Exam fees
  • 3,500 (for General, OBC, EWS)
  • 2,500 (for SC/ST/PWD/Physically Handicapped)

NEET PG 2025 Important Dates (Tentative)

Event Tentative Dates
Beginning of registration Last week of April 2025
Deadline to submit application form 3rd week of May 2025
Uploading of admit card 2nd week of June 2025
NEET PG 2025 exam date June 15, 2025
Declaration of result Last week of June 2025

NEET PG 2025 Exam Pattern

The NBE will release the NEET PG 2025 exam pattern and the official brochure. Candidates can review the highlights of the NEET PG 2025 exam pattern in the table below. The exam pattern includes information about the exam, such as the exam mode, medium, total number of questions and their type, and marking scheme. The exam will have negative markings, with candidates receiving +4 marks for each correct response, -1 marks for incorrect responses, and 0 marks for an unattempted answer:

NEET PG 2025 Exam Pattern Highlights

Particulars Details
Mode of the examination Computer-based Test
Medium of the examination English (only)
Duration of the examination 3.5 hours
Total marks 800
Number of questions 200
Type of questions Multiple-choice questions
Negative marking Yes

FAQs

1. What is the NEET PG 2025 syllabus?
Answer: The syllabus is on the MBBS curriculum and covers subjects such as Anatomy, Physiology, Biochemistry, Pathology, Pharmacology, Microbiology, Forensic Medicine, Social and Preventive Medicine, General Medicine, General Surgery, Obstetrics and Gynaecology, Paediatrics, ENT, and Ophthalmology.

2. Can foreign medical graduates appear for NEET PG 2025?
Answer: Yes, foreign medical graduates are eligible, subject to passing the Foreign Medical Graduate Examination (FMGE) and finishing their internship before the stipulated date.

3. What is the fee for applying for NEET PG 2025?
Answer: The application fee is INR 3,500 for General/OBC/EWS candidates and INR 2,500 for SC/ST/PWD candidates. Payment can be done online using a net banking facility, debit card, or credit card.

4. Is re-evaluation or re-checking of NEET PG 2025 answer sheets allowed?
Answer: No, the NBE does not allow any re-evaluation or re-checking of answer sheets. The announced results are final.

5. How long is the NEET PG 2025 score valid?
Answer: The NEET PG 2025 score is generally only valid for the ongoing admission session. Candidates are advised to confirm specific information from official sources or the concerned counseling authorities.
